EU releases more funding for innovative medicines
A second formal call for research proposals from the pharmaceutical industry has been made by the European Union's innovative medicines initiative.

The joint venture operated by the European Commission (EC) and the European Federation of Pharmaceutical Industries and Associations wants research consortia to bid for funding on nine topics. The EC is contributing Euro 76.8m matched by in-kind donations from pharmaceutical companies.
Three topics would improve knowledge management, focusing on improving data standards to help evaluate new medicine efficacy and safety of new medicines and ease the sharing of information accelerating drug development.
The six other topics focus on improving drugs against cancer, inflammatory and infectious diseases.
